Condition

This work is in very good condition overall. There are staple holes around the edges, presumably from a previous stretching. There are scattered lines of fine craquelure and small surface abrasions with some associated losses which fluoresce brightly under ultraviolet light and which are presumably inherent to the artist's working method. Otherwise, under ultraviolet light inspection there is no apparent restoration. Framed under Plexiglas.
